If you're looking for a great location to learn how to drive, try driving around the outskirts of Edinburgh or along the A90. The A90 is very crowded and is a great spot to practice Driving Instructor Training in traffic and around roundabouts. You can also practice your hill-starting skills on estate roads like Old Craiighall Road, Sherriffhall Road and Millerhill Road. Narrow streets

If you're seeking a unique and interesting method to explore Edinburgh take a stroll down one of the city's old narrow streets. These streets are called closes or wynds, and were once busy places of work and homes. They are now a great location for people to walk around and take photographs. Many of these streets have been closed to cars for more than 400 years. You can still stroll along the narrow streets to learn about their history.

These narrow paths, also known as "closes" permit access to buildings that are behind the structures that line the streets. They are an essential part of Edinburgh's historic core. The Royal Mile, the spine of the old town, is a fantastic location to begin an exploration of the city's closings. It runs from a hill-top castle to the royal palace, and is crammed with cafes, shops, and museums. The streets that run off the Royal Mile offer a glimpse of the secret life that is the city.

Often named after a past resident, the closes were once private alleyways that residents hid in at late at night. The closes were also the perfect place to breed bubonic plague that struck Edinburgh, killing nearly half of the population in 1645. The remaining inhabitants built up to avoid squalid ground floors and the smell of open sewers.
